I have seen mental health providers on and of for many years. I am new to the area and needed a new psychiatrist. Dr. Andewelt was easy to talk to, and I felt she was non-judgmental. She was very thorough and asked a lot of questions- some that I have never been asked before- and they were thought provoking. She explained that she doesn't just refill medications- but evaluates the whole picture, and the effect that those medications are having on one's current state. She wants to make sure that each medication is currently needed, that there are not potentially dangerous medication combinations, and that all of the necessary symptoms were being treated. She was very direct saying that if my alcohol use was the primary problem- an addiction psychiatrist would be the best fit for me. She explained her recommendations and made sure that I participated in creating the plan for moving forward. I left the appointment feeling lucky that I got in (she had a cancellation- otherwise, I would have had to see someone else because my medications are running out and her next available intake was not for a while.)
